Is the discount on the entire bill - including the tax or just the food portion?
 
It is taken before they add tax and then they tax you on what you are paying for so it does take off some of the tax you would pay. The tip however is figured on the amount you ordered not what you paid. Agree with this. Tax calculated on food/alcohol total after discount, tip calculated on total before discount.

Is the discount on the entire bill - including the tax or just the food portion?
Check is $100 + tax (7%??) = $107

Tip is 18% of original food + beverage total = $18.

Now, reduce check by 20% for TiW - ($100-$20) $80…add recalculated tax (7%?? - $5.60) = $85.60 + $18 tip = $103.60.

Think of it this way - after applying TiW discount - you save a few dollars from the original amount and the tip has been paid.
 
The TiW can be purchased by Florida Residents, DVC Members, and Annual Passholders. It gives a 20% discount on food and beverages (including alcoholic) at most tables service and some quick services location on WDW for up to ten people at a time. When you purchase it, the card is valid for the remainder of the current month plus 13 full months.

Here is a working example, using $100.00 as the original bill to make the math show up easily. Note this is for Table Service. At Counter Service there is no gratuity added.

100.00 - Original Menu Amount
*20.00 - Discount
*80.00 - Subtotal
*18.00 - Gratuity Added based on $100
**5.20 - Sales Tax on $80
103.20 - Final amount charged, takes into consideration discount, gratuity and tax.

Without TiW Discount (and still figuring 18% Gratuity)

100.00 - Original Menu Amount
*18.00 - Gratuity
**6.50 - Sales Tax on $100
124.50 - Total

$21.30 - Savings using TiW Card.

* Ignore the asterisks; they are there only so the columns/numbers line up properly.

For the complete list of locations and the rules, go to www.tablesinwonderland.com which is the Official Disney site.

Based on the current pricing, the following is the break-even point for menu pricing (assuming you will routinely give an 18% tip):
AP Holder or DVC Member ($100) is $469.48
Resident (not AP holder) ($150) is $704.23
Both of the above take into consideration that the Sales Tax is also discounted.
